Alloy Wheel Colour Change Apps: See New Looks on Your Car Without Spending Money
Many people love alloy wheels on their cars. They make the car look sporty and modern. But changing the real colour of wheels costs money and time. You paint them or buy new ones.
Now, there are apps that let you try wheel colour change on your phone. These are called wheel visualizers or colour change apps. You take a photo of your car, and the app shows how different colours or styles look.
Why These Apps Are So Useful
- Save money: No need to buy wheels just to see if they look good.
- Try many options fast: Change from silver to black, matte, chrome, or bright colours in seconds.
- Help decide: See if a new colour matches your car body.
- Fun for car lovers: Play with looks before real changes like painting or powder coating.
Popular Ways These Apps Work
- Take a photo of your car from the side so wheels show clearly.
- The app uses AI or tools to find the wheels.
- Choose colours like black, gunmetal, bronze, or custom paints.
- Some apps let you change caliper colour (the brake part) too.
- See it in real time or save photos to share.
Examples of similar tools (no single app called “Alloy App” for this, but many do the job):
- Cartomizer app: Take a picture of your car, try different wheels and styles, then buy if you like.
- TunAR app: Uses augmented reality (AR) to place new wheels or colours on your car in live view.
- Big O Tires or Discount Tire visualizers: Pick brands, sizes, finishes, and see on your car model.
- Pixelcut AI Wheel Fitment Visualizer: Upload photo, describe dream rims (like “matte black alloy”), and AI shows it.
- MAK or Fondmetal configurators: 3D views to pick colours like diamond cut or black.
These tools help avoid bad choices. For example, black wheels look great on white cars but may hide dirt on dark cars.

Smartwatch Zinc Alloy: Strong Watches with Companion Apps
Smartwatches are very popular now. They track steps, heart rate, sleep, calls, and more. Many good ones use zinc alloy for the case.
Zinc alloy is a mix of zinc with other metals. It is:
- Strong and hard to break
- Light for daily wear
- Cheap compared to steel or titanium
- Can look premium with good finish (like shiny or matte)
Many budget and mid-range smartwatches use zinc alloy cases. They feel solid and last long.
Why Zinc Alloy Is Good for Smartwatches
- Durable: Handles daily bumps without cracks.
- Good looks: Often comes in black, silver, gold, or gunmetal colours.
- Waterproof: Many have IP67 or IP68 rating (can handle water and sweat).
- Comfort: Light so you forget you wear it.
Examples of zinc alloy smartwatches:
- Brands like BRIBEJAT, fanruina, Boult, or generic models on Amazon, Walmart, Alibaba, or eBay.
- Features: Big screens (1.32″ to 2.01″), heart rate, SpO2 (oxygen), 100+ sports modes, calls, music control, voice assistant.
- They pair with phones via Bluetooth and use apps.
The companion app (often called the smartwatch app) is key. It connects the watch to your phone (Android or iPhone). Through the app you:
- Set up the watch
- Sync data like steps or sleep
- Change watch faces
- Get notifications
- Update software
Common apps for these watches: Wear OS apps, or brand apps like JYouPro, or general ones like Da Fit or VeryFitPro.

Causeway Alloy Tool: Professional App for Asset Management

This is different from car or watch apps. Causeway Alloy (now CausewayOne Asset Management) is software for big organizations like local governments.
It helps manage assets like roads, bridges, street lights, signs, drainage, parks, and more.
Main Features of Causeway Alloy Apps
- See assets on maps.
- Record inspections, repairs, and work.
- Track maintenance to save money.
- Share data between teams.
- Mobile app for workers in the field (Alloy Mobile).
- New “Alloy Apps” launched around 2025 make it faster and easier.
Why it’s useful:
- For highways, cleansing, waste, trees, etc.
- Automates tasks so less paper work.
- Helps make smart decisions with data.
- Used in UK for councils and infrastructure.
The tool has apps for different jobs:
- Maps app to view and edit on map.
- Data Explorer for queries and bulk changes.
- Mobile for field work.
